Quick start

Capture your first conversation and see what Banter does with it — right in the browser, nothing to install.

Banter’s core loop is simple: record a conversation, get a speaker-labeled transcript next to your notes, then hand the whole thing to AI. You can run the loop end to end in about two minutes.

What you need

  • A Banter account (app.usebanter.ai)
  • Chrome or Edge for shared audio; available audio sources depend on your browser and operating system

Capture your first conversation

  1. Open a note — any note. Recordings live inside notes, so whatever note is open is where the recording lands.
  2. Click the microphone button in the editor toolbar.
  3. Pick a source:
    • Microphone — just you talking, or people in the room with you.
    • System audio + microphone — you’re in an online meeting. In the browser’s share picker, choose Entire screen and turn on Share system audio. This captures your computer’s audio and your microphone.
  4. Talk for 30 seconds.
  5. Click the microphone again to stop.

The recording uploads and, a few minutes later, the note has a full transcript with speaker labels and timestamps, plus a summary.

Now ask your AI about it

Press Cmd+L (Ctrl+L on Windows) to open the assistant and try:

Draft a follow-up email from this note.

The assistant reads the transcript and note, drafts the email, and cites what it used — every claim links back to the note or transcript line it came from.
